Quick Example

Minimal component demonstrating preferred patterns:

<script setup lang="ts">
import { ref, computed } from 'vue'

const props = defineProps<{ initialCount?: number }>()

const count = ref(props.initialCount ?? 0)
const doubled = computed(() => count.value * 2)

function increment() {
  count.value++
}
</script>

<template>
  <button @click="increment">Count: {{ count }} (doubled: {{ doubled }})</button>
</template>

Constraints

MUST DO

  • Use Composition API (NOT Options API)
  • Use <script setup> syntax for components
  • Use type-safe props with TypeScript
  • Use ref() for primitives, reactive() for objects
  • Use computed() for derived state
  • Use proper lifecycle hooks (onMounted, onUnmounted, etc.)
  • Implement proper cleanup in composables
  • Use Pinia for global state management

MUST NOT DO

  • Use Options API (data, methods, computed as object)
  • Mix Composition API with Options API
  • Mutate props directly
  • Create reactive objects unnecessarily
  • Use watch when computed is sufficient
  • Forget to cleanup watchers and effects
  • Access DOM before onMounted
  • Use Vuex (deprecated in favor of Pinia)
